A man who has been offering a show called “Eclecti-Celt” for a couple of decades now, turning his lifelong love for the music, prose, poetry, and propaganda of the Celtic nations (Ireland, Scotland, Wales, Cornwall, Man, … WebJan 7, 2024 · Slew comes from Irish sluagh “an army, crowd, multitude.”. It entered English in the mid-1800s. The word slogan also stems partly from the same word. sluagh-ghairm is a Gaelic term (either Irish or Scottish Gaelic) meaning “battle cry,” referring to battle cries used by Scottish and Irish clans.
